June 3, 200323 yr Hi BryanThe entry numbers are missing from your example so this is just a guess.. Your first 'paint' should be fltsim.0. The second will be fltsim.1, the third.. fltsim.2.. etc.Also, I believe there is a limit to how many versions you can for a single AC type. It's fairly high so unless you have a dozen or more, this is unlikely to be the case.Have a look at that./Danno
